Requirements: Wireless home network (like a wireless router) WITHOUT WEP

Run the program for the computer and it minimizes to system tray, set up the DS and use the touch screen to control your mouse. This works more like a tablet than a touchpad, so if you touch the upperleft of the touchscreen, your mouse will move to the upper left. Touch the middle, you mouse jumps to the middle. Move your stylus from bottom right to bottom left, your mouse moves from bottom right to bottom left. L is left click, and UP is right click. Enjoy.

NOTE: If you don't know all the info it asks for, go to where your connections are (Control Panel>Network Connections) and double click Local Area Connection, go to Support tab. That has all the info you'll need.

Win2DS seems to be updated: http://digitalatrocity.com/DS/Win2DS.zip

It now has password protection, a keyboard input for settings, and an autoupdating image of your desktop on the bottom screen so you can see what you're moving your mouse over, and a keyboard as well.

Quote from: "AnalogMan"I thin kMAC filtering is better than WEP. WEP is easliy cracked (it's only a matter of time before a WEP cracker makes it's way to the DS. MAC address is more protecting.

Not really, it's pretty easy to MAC address spoofing. It may be a bit better at keeping people from accessing your network, but without encryption anyone with a wifi device can "pick up" data you send. So if you are doing anything private and it's not encrypted, your neighbor can see what it is your doing.
